CPU comparisonIntel Xeon W-3335 or Intel Pentium Gold G7400 -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.
The Intel Xeon W-3335 has 16 cores with 32 threads and clocks with a maximum frequency of 4.00 GHz. Up to 4096 GB of memory is supported in 8 memory channels. The Intel Xeon W-3335 was released in Q3/2021. The Intel Pentium Gold G7400 has 2 cores with 4 threads and clocks with a maximum frequency of 3.70 GHz. The CPU supports up to 128 GB of memory in 2 memory channels. The Intel Pentium Gold G7400 was released in Q1/2022. |

Memory & PCIeThe Intel Xeon W-3335 can use up to 4096 GB of memory in 8 memory channels. The maximum memory bandwidth is 204.8 GB/s. The Intel Pentium Gold G7400 supports up to 128 GB of memory in 2 memory channels and achieves a memory bandwidth of up to 76.8 GB/s. |

Thermal ManagementThe thermal design power (TDP for short) of the Intel Xeon W-3335 is 250 W, while the Intel Pentium Gold G7400 has a TDP of 46 W. The TDP specifies the necessary cooling solution that is required to cool the processor sufficiently. |
